Well let's just hope Ventrone doesn't win the annual Bam Childress award. A player who works hard, has an impressive camp, gets lots of praise and then cut every time.
 
I personally don't care for the Aiken hype and I'd love to see a guy like Ventrone make the team for his versatility. But we need to look at numbers here.
QB- 3 Brady, Gutz, KOC
RB- 4/5 Maroney Morris Faulk Evans Jordan
WR- 5 Moss Gaffney Welker Jackson Washington
TE- 2 Watson Thomas
LT- 2 Light Britt
LG- 2 Mankins Hochstein
C- 1/2 Koppen Connolly
RG- 1/2 (3 when Neal returns) Flynn Yates Welbourn?
RT- 2 Kaczur O'Callahan

DL- 5/6 Seymour Warren Wilfork Wright Green (LK Smith?)
OLB- 4 Adalius Vrabel Woods Crable
ILB- 5 Bruschi Mayo Alexander Izzo Guyton
S- 5 Harrison Lynch Meriweather Spann Sanders
CB- 3 Hobbs Bryant Wheatley
plus K, P, LS
That's just a rough estimate but that comes to 51 guys. The limit is 53 and it doesn't include Aiken, or draft picks like Wilhite, Slater etc. It'll be very close, RV could easily be player #53, but on that top 51 list (give or take a Guyton/Alexander) I don't see anyone who would be cut in favor of Ray.
Like I said, I hope he makes it but it's really a number crunch at this point.
